Long, long ago, in ancient times, people built the first harbours to protect their boats from rough waves π. The Egyptians built harbours on the
Nile River around 3000 BC! β
For centuries, sailors used harbours to travel, trade, and catch fish π. The Romans made big harbours in places like Ostia, Italy, to help their ships. As technology grew, harbours got bigger and better! Today, harbours have special equipment to help with loading and unloading cargo, making them super busy places filled with action π’!
